#c99124 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c99124 is composed of 78.8% red, 56.9%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.9% magenta, 82.1%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 39.6 degrees, a saturation of 69.6% and a lightness of 46.5%. #c99124 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ff48 with #932300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

● #c99124 color description : Strong orange.
#c99124 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c99124 has RGB values of R:201, G:145,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.82,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13209892.

Shades and Tints of #c99124
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c99124
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777776 is the less saturated color, while #e49a09 is the most saturated one.
